Explore this Property

Super NW OKC location. Close to all amenities. Join one of OKC's finest complexes with community swimming pool, rec facility and lovely grounds. This well built complex comes complete with a rare 2 car garage with each unit. This 2 story unit comes with real wood burning fireplace, small wet bar and small quiet private courtyard. Location provides easy access to all metro areas via NW Highway and/or Hefner Parkway. Owner very motivated and will consider an updating allowance. Come see for yourself.
